A club that most of us have never heard of despite the fact that they were unbeaten for a massive 59 games is Armenian club, Shirak. The oldest club in Armenian history, Shirak created history with their phenomenal achievement that spanned across two seasons between 1993-95.
"We had our leaders, but all the players were ready to burst into action and show their strength. We had a good working atmosphere in the team and also that winning spirit. That's why we were unbeatable," said Andranik Adamyan who coached them in the early 90s.
